Currently, table creation from SQL client such as below works well {code:sql} CREATE TABLE kafkaTable ( user_id BIGINT, item_id BIGINT, category_id BIGINT, behavior STRING, ts TIMESTAMP(3) ) WITH ( 'connector' = 'kafka', 'topic' = 'user_behavior', 'properties.bootstrap.servers' = 'localhost:9092', 'properties.group.id' = 'testGroup', 'format' = 'avro', 'scan.startup.mode' = 'earliest-offset' ) {code} Although I would wish for the table creation to support Confluent Kafka configuration as well. For example some think like {code:sql} CREATE TABLE kafkaTable ( user_id BIGINT, item_id BIGINT, category_id BIGINT, behavior STRING, ts TIMESTAMP(3) ) WITH ( 'connector' = 'kafka-confluent', 'topic' = 'user_behavior', 'properties.bootstrap.servers' = 'localhost:9092', 'properties.group.id' = 'testGroup', 'schema-registry' = 'http://schema-registry.com', 'scan.startup.mode' = 'earliest-offset' ) {code} Additionally, it will be better if we can - specify 'parallelism' within WITH clause to support parallel partition processing - specify custom properties within WITH clause specified in [https://docs.confluent.io/5.4.2/installation/configuration/consumer-configs.html] -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)
